Highpoint Health, Beacon Ortho Offer School Sports Physicals April 3

(Lawrenceburg, Ind.) – Highpoint Health is joining with Beacon Orthopaedics & Sports Medicine to once again offer sports physicals for students who will be entering grades 6 through 12 this fall.  The event is scheduled for Tuesday, April 3, from 3:30 to 6:30 p.m. at Highpoint Health, 600 Wilson Creek Road, Lawrenceburg.

Registration for the event will take place in the main lobby of Highpoint Health, with physicals performed upstairs in the second floor conference area.

Students receiving a physical will pass through various stations including height and weight; vision; ear, nose and throat; blood pressure and heart rate; and spine and extremities.  Those participating are requested to wear shorts to the event and each student athlete will be presented a complimentary T-shirt.

The cost of the physical is $20 per person with $10 for each student being donated back to the athletic department of their respective school.  Cash, major credit and debit cards, and personal checks made payable to Highpoint Health will be accepted.

Sports physicals are open to all appropriate student athletes, regardless of school affiliation.  Last year, more than 300 students from Southeastern Indiana received physicals at the event.

For additional information, please contact Highpoint Health Physical Therapy & Sports Medicine at (812) 537-8144 or (800) 676-5572, ext. 8144.
